    any good accommodation near the city centre,looking for 2 singles and as cheap as possible


Comments

  • Closed Accounts Posts: 125 ✭✭nycman


    If you're looking for value there are 4 hostels in the centre. Kinlay House, The Salmon Weir Hostel, Snoozles and Sleepzone.

    They're your best bet I believe
